在当今的网页设计中,响应式导航栏是确保网站在不同设备和屏幕尺寸上都能提供良好用户体验的关键。以下将详细介绍五大关键技巧,帮助您解锁完美适配的响应式导航栏布局。
技巧一:灵活的布局设计
主题句:灵活的布局设计是响应式导航栏适配的基础。
在布局设计中,应采用弹性网格系统(如Flexbox或CSS Grid)来确保导航栏元素能够根据屏幕大小进行调整。以下是一个使用Flexbox的简单示例:
.navbar {
display: flex;
justify-content: space-between;
align-items: center;
}
.navbar-item {
flex-grow: 1;
text-align: center;
}
通过这种方式,导航栏中的每个元素都能根据屏幕宽度自动调整大小和位置。
技巧二:媒体查询优化
主题句:使用媒体查询可以针对不同屏幕尺寸进行特定样式调整。
媒体查询允许您根据屏幕宽度或其他特性应用不同的CSS样式。以下是一个针对小屏幕设备的媒体查询示例:
@media (max-width: 600px) {
.navbar {
flex-direction: column;
}
.navbar-item {
margin-bottom: 10px;
}
}
在这个例子中,当屏幕宽度小于600px时,导航栏将变为垂直布局,每个导航项之间有适当的间距。
技巧三:触屏友好的交互设计
主题句:触屏友好的交互设计对于移动设备用户至关重要。
在移动设备上,导航栏应易于点击和操作。以下是一些提高触屏友好性的建议:
- 确保导航按钮的尺寸足够大,方便手指点击。
- 使用清晰的字体和颜色对比,提高可读性。
- 考虑添加汉堡菜单(Hamburger menu)作为移动设备上的导航选项。
技巧四:视觉层次和焦点
主题句:合理的视觉层次和焦点可以帮助用户快速找到所需内容。
在导航栏设计中,应使用视觉层次来引导用户注意力。以下是一些实现方法:
- 使用不同的字体大小、颜色和图标来区分导航项。
- 为当前页面或选中的导航项添加高亮效果。
- 确保视觉层次与内容的逻辑结构相匹配。
技巧五:测试和优化
主题句:持续的测试和优化是确保响应式导航栏性能的关键。
在开发过程中,应不断测试导航栏在不同设备和浏览器上的表现。以下是一些测试和优化的建议:
- 使用真实设备进行测试,包括不同品牌和型号的手机和平板电脑。
- 使用浏览器开发者工具模拟不同屏幕尺寸和分辨率。
- 收集用户反馈,并根据反馈进行相应调整。
通过以上五大关键技巧,您可以解锁完美适配的响应式导航栏布局,为用户提供一致且优质的浏览体验。
